Judge in Cantu case seals autopsy details
ShareThisBy Cynthia Hubert
chubert@sacbee.com
Published: Saturday, Apr. 25, 2009 - 12:00 am | Page 3A
STOCKTON – A San Joaquin County judge on Friday agreed to seal the details of an autopsy on the body of little Sandra Cantu of Tracy.

Superior Court Judge Linda Lofthus, in response to a request by the District Attorney's Office, said releasing the report could cause public outrage and make it impossible for the woman charged with raping and killing Sandra, 8, to get a fair trial.

It also would be "an invasion of the Cantu family's privacy rights," Lofthus added.

The ruling came during Melissa Chantel Huckaby's second courtroom appearance since being charged with kidnapping, raping and slaying Sandra, whose body was found earlier this month in a suitcase floating in an irrigation pond. The girl had been missing for 10 days, and had last been seen skipping through the trailer park where she lived with her mother, Maria Chavez.

People in Tracy and across the country became mesmerized by the case, and more than 2,500 people attended Sandra's public memorial service.

Huckaby, 28, was a neighbor of Sandra and her family at the Orchard Estates Mobile Home Park, and her daughter frequently played with Sandra.

Shackled and wearing a red jail jumpsuit Friday, Huckaby sat quietly next to public defender Sam Behar, staring straight ahead and showing no emotion.

Several of her family members, seated behind her in the courtroom, shed tears.

If Huckaby is convicted, she could face life in prison without the possibility of parole or the death penalty.

She has yet to enter a plea.

Relatives and friends of Sandra and her family, some wearing shirts imprinted with the girl's image, sat on the opposite side of the packed courtroom from Huckaby's family.

The court assigned 21 seats for the victim's family and five seats for the defendant's family.

It also issued 26 media credentials, using a lottery system to award seats to reporters. Thirty members of the public were issued seats, and the court turned away at least 20 others who were interested in watching the brief hearing.

Lofthus noted that the case has generated national attention in print, on television and radio and on the Internet.

"It's a kind of case we have never had in San Joaquin County," she said. "Most courts never have this kind of case."

In the age of the 24-hour news cycle, she said, releasing the results of autopsy and toxicology tests would generate an instant firestorm of coverage.

"There is no doubt in my mind that it would be disseminated before I even walked out of the door today," she said. "The public views sexual assault and homicide of a child as a heinous crime."

So, in the "overriding interest" of assembling an unbiased jury and ensuring a fair trial, the judge said, she decided to seal the reports until further notice.

Prosecutor Thomas Tesla told the judge that he has turned over more than 500 pages of evidence to the defense and needs several weeks to prepare and distribute other reports. Lofthus set the next hearing for May 22.

In another development Friday, public defender Behar withdrew his request that the girl's body be exhumed so that it can be examined for more evidence. Behar offered no explanation, and he and other lawyers and investigators are subject to a gag order prohibiting them from talking about the case.

Police: no apparent connection between northern CA murder and LC Valley
Published: Apr 24, 2009 at 11:22 PM PDT

Story Updated: Apr 24, 2009 at 11:22 PM PDT


LEWISTON - Reports of a connection between the grandfather of the woman charged with the grisly murder of a little girl in northern California and the LC Valley appear to have little substance to them.

Bay Area television stations were making calls to law enforcement and others on both sides of the LC Valley Thursday night and Friday, looking to confirm reports that Clifford Lane Lawless, the grandfather of 28-year-old Melissa Huckaby, had been a pastor at a local church and may have been the subject of a child abuse investigation.

But after checking Friday, there was no link to the Valley discovered.

Pastor Bill Creutzberg of the Warner Alliance Church did confirm that he had been interviewed by the FBI concerning the case on Good Friday, but said he told them the same thing he told Action News, that he knows nothing about Lawless.

The Asotin County Sheriff's Office and Clarkston Police also have no information about Lawless and Captain Tom Greene with Lewiston Police said the FBI had contacted LPD about Lawless, but that Lewiston Police have no records with Lawless’ name on them

Huckaby is charged with murder and rape for the death of 8-year-old Sandra Cantu of Tracy, California.

The FBI told Action News Friday that they can’t comment on the investigation.

Huckaby linked to SoCal arson case

Melissa Huckaby, accused of killing 8-year-old Sandra Cantu, has been linked to two house fires when she lived in Southern California in 2007.

Evelyn Lloyd, Huckaby’s roommate for eight months, said in a phone interview today from Southern California that police should look more closely at Huckaby’s involvement in the two fires that damaged the four-bedroom house they shared in La Palma.

Orange County Superior Court records show that Lloyd, 47, was charged with a felony count of arson on July 19, 2007. She spent 10 days in jail and was placed on suicide watch. The case against her was later dismissed.

La Palma police Capt. Jim Enright said today that Huckaby was considered a person of interest in two fires set at a home where she lived in 2007.

Citing a gag order placed on the murder case by San Joaquin County Judge Linda Lofthus, Enright declined to comment further. Huckaby is in jail and stands accused of Sandra’s murder, kidnapping and rape with a foreign object.

The first fire broke out on July 19 and the other was eight days later — while Lloyd was in jail.

Lloyd said she suspected Huckaby and also their landlord, Judy Minchey.

“I was living in this lady’s house for 12 years, and I knew the personality and the makeup of the people,” she said. “All this stuff started happening when Melissa moved into the house.”

No charges were ever filed against Huckaby or Minchey, who could not be reached for comment.

After the first fire, Lloyd said, police found a baby’s bottle with gasoline, a threatening letter and newspapers stuffed in the side window of her first-story room.

“Either she (Huckaby) wanted my bedroom, or she blackmailed the landlord and it got too out of whack, because six days after I was locked up, the landlord’s house was on fire,” said Lloyd.

According to Lloyd, the fire that happened while she was in jail started in the living room. Authorities said the two fires caused nearly $90,000 in damages.

Ten days earlier, Lloyd said she was served with an eviction notice because Minchey felt her attitude was unacceptable. That day, Lloyd said she found that all of her electrical cords were cut. The next day, she said her clothes were bleached. That Wednesday, Lloyd said she found written in big, blue letters on her bedroom door, “Get out of here, n----r!”

After this happened, she said La Palma police only questioned Minchey, not Huckaby.

Lloyd said police pointed to her attitude, military experience and the fact that she had sent her 13-year-old daughter to live with a babysitter in Los Angeles 10 days earlier as evidence that she had committed the arson. Her landlord also implicated her, she said.

“(Minchey) said I walked in the house, I lit the curtains, ran into the burning house, closed my door and waited for the police to come rescue me,” Lloyd said. “They said that I looked like I set it up the whole week and did all that stuff to myself.”

Lloyd estimated that 25 or 30 women lived in the house at different times but were driven out by Minchey’s odd rules and strict attitude.

One day, Lloyd said, she and Huckaby talked about how the landlord insisted clothes had to be washed in Tide detergent. She said she’s sure Minchey overheard her suggest that Huckaby could buy cheaper soap and pour it into a Tide bottle.

Like Lloyd, Huckaby had a daughter living in the home. The two initially bonded as Lloyd showed her how to survive in what she described a “toxic” environment.

“When Melissa moved in, I befriended her,” Lloyd said. “I told her the landlord only has one motive (to make money). So I became a mother hen to her. I felt like I had to wrap my arms around her and protect her.”

Lloyd said this whole ordeal has turned her life upside down. Before this, she considered herself a good role model, a medical courier who was a veteran of Desert Storm. Now she said her reputation has been damaged.

“I want justification; I want to be vindicated on all levels,” Lloyd said. “I’m so numb about it because my life is finally getting back on track.”

Judge in Cantu case won't escape scrutiny
Huckaby trial only latest emotionally charged case Lofthus to oversee

<snipped>
STOCKTON - Melissa Huckaby's trial on charges she raped and murdered 8-year-old Sandra Cantu won't be the first emotion-riddled case to play out before San Joaquin County Superior Court Judge Linda Lofthus.

Lofthus teared up three years ago listening to testimony from the friend of a 22-year-old man stabbed to death in front of a bar. That led defense attorneys to say she showed bias against a pair Jus Brothers Motorcycle Club members convicted in the killing.

Lofthus, 56, also faltered in an emotional moment on the bench late last year while sentencing convicted serial killer William Jennings Choyce to death for murdering three prostitutes. It was the first capital murder case for Lofthus.

When Huckaby, 28, steps into Lofthus' courtroom Friday for the first time, she'll confront a judge who receives quiet criticism from some local attorneys and high praise from an unlikely place - the attorney of the only person she's ever sentenced to death.

"There's no doubt she'll work as hard as necessary," Choyce's Oakland-based attorney, Lorna Patton-Brown said of Lofthus, adding that the pressure of such a high-profile case will be punishing.

In Choyce's case, Lofthus didn't always rule in the defendant's favor, but Patton-Brown credited the judge with researching and reading every case brought before her.

Each morning, Lofthus greeted Choyce and treated him respectfully, said Brown, adding that she expects Lofthus to give Huckaby the same even-handed treatment.

"For doing such a difficult, hard and awful case, it was as pleasant as it possibly could be for us," Patton-Brown said.

Huckaby faces a potential death sentence on the murder charge with three special circumstances of kidnapping, rape with a foreign object and lewd and lascivious acts on a child younger than 14.
